Docket No. 1:06-cv-321 Charles Jay Wolff v. NH Department of Corrections, Jeff Perkins, Gency Morse and James Daly ACCEPTANCE OF SERVICE This is to notify the Court that the New Hampshire Department of Justice, Office of the Attorney General, accepts service on behalf of Defendants, William Wrenn, Commissioner, NH Department of Corrections, pursuant to the Court's Report and Recommendation dated January 26, 2007) (Muirhead, J.). Consistent with the Federal Rules of Civil Procedure, the State reserves the right to challenge this Court's subject matter jurisdiction, and to raise any and all other objections. See Fed. R. Civ.
